Batman Beyond (2014) Review

download
Batman’s 75th Anniversary continues to bring us more animation that is not only cutting edge, but also DCAU styled. Strange Days was a pretty good animation and it even had a plot. This short is much….shorter, but we still get a basic plot and even a villain. There is a cliffhanger which can maybe be wrapped up in a future installment, but probably just in our minds!

The short starts out with Batman Beyond realizing that the Batcave has been infiltrated and Bruce (BATMAN) Wayne has already been dealt with. That’s when Batman appears, but he seems different somehow. Batman Beyond has no time to think about this as the fight begins. He’s on the losing end of the battle for a while and this is probably what fans would expect from a fight between the two. It’s definitely fun to see Batman beat him up, but technically Batman Beyond can definitely fight on par with him thanks to his super suit. Will Batman Beyond live through this experience!?

The ending is probably the best part of the short. We get some pretty epic music that all fans of the original TV show should recognize and we also notice that Batman Beyond is completely doomed. If Bruce Wayne doesn’t get into costume quickly…this will get ugly. The homages to the other versions of Batman were great and the best one would be the original or seeing the classic The Batman get in there.

The animation and color scheme was spot on from the original show. That’s what I want to see when I turn on my TV. 5 Star entertainment. The voice acting was superb as expected and a new season of this show would immediately be one of the best superhero shows around. I doubt that any of DC’s future shorts will be able to defeat this one unless they go ahead and make a Justice League version. (Which will probably happen at some point)

Overall, this was easily the best DC short so far. We got some incredible action and the villain was pretty impressive. Seeing the DCAU back in action is an inspiration to us all and it shows that DC still remembers how to put out an epic show. I highly recommend this short to all DC fans and really to fans of Marvel as well. Agents of Smash and Avengers Assemble could learn a few things from this short. Batman Beyond already looks more impressive than all of Marvel’s current superheroes in animation. Hopefully we get another animation soon!

Overall 9/10
